The size of Mckail is approximately 9.9 square kilometres. It has 3 parks covering nearly 3.0% of total area. The population of Mckail in 2016 was 3445 people. By 2021 the population was 3970 showing a population growth of 15.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mckail is 0-9 years. Households in Mckail are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mckail work in a community and personal service occupation.In 2021, 72.80% of the homes in Mckail were owner-occupied compared with 71.50% in 2016.
